During the summer, I work at Glazed Over Studios located on Asbury Avenue in Ocean City, New Jersey. I am the art camp instructor there from June until August. My camps consist of kids ages 6-13, and the class sizes range anywhere from 4 students to 8 students. We explore various mediums, including clay, mosaics, acrylic paint, water color paint, collage, and much more! It is a wonderful experience, and I will continue to be the summer art camp instructor for years to come! STEAM Camp
Stop-Motion Animation
Students developed a project design and then created their background images, as well as any props needed. The students used the iPads to create a short animated video using the Stop Motion app! An example of one of the videos can be seen below.
Squishy Circuits
Using Play doh, modeling clay, 9 volt batteries, red/black wires, and LED Diodes, students are able to create light due to the transfer of electricity through the sculpting materials!
Clay Camp
Students created a wide range of unique and detailed clay projects throughout the week of clay camp. Each student designed and developed their own ideas. We took a tour of the kiln room as well in order to see how their creations turned into bisque and then greenware.
Painting Camp
Throughout this camp, students learned different painting techniques and dabbled in various types of paint, including watercolors, acrylic paint, and tempera paint.
